TERA is the inaugural work of South Korean MMO developer Bluehole Studios. Bluehole was formed in 2007 by a handful of ex-NCsoft employees, including the producer, lead game designer, lead programmer, and art director of Lineage II, which would explain why the game looks so lovely. Play is another thing entirely, however, and I was never big fan of how Lineage II played. Hopefully TERA’s action-based combat system will differentiate from the older title.
